About this Event

Step into a world of daring deeds, thunderous cannons, and salty sea stories across five unforgettable days of pirate-packed family fun.

 

After two years sailing the high seas, the legendary pirates of Griffin Historical are returning to Jersey and dropping anchor once more, and they arrive with impeccable pirate credentials. From staging events for Historic Royal Palaces and English Heritage, to publishing books on piracy, working in film and television, and even appearing in Pirates of the Caribbean, these are pirates who truly know their trade. And despite their global adventures, they still declare the Maritime Museum in Jersey their favourite port of call.

 

Climb aboard for thrilling tales, hunt for hidden knowledge, hands-on creativity, and an epic live-action battle. Muster your courage, sharpen your (imaginary) cutlass, and join us this half term for an adventure that’s loud, lively, and truly legendary.
